Output 5ed31118700daf92b1ad5132fe186082c8ce923f0885623f29c847942762be35:22

value
136000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ae78391d1aafb1fbd6d87f94075fed49673d4107 OP_EQUAL
address
3HbXXAo8NszSzDbCkWCm3RGfPQQDo4Arzm
transaction
5ed31118700daf92b1ad5132fe186082c8ce923f0885623f29c847942762be35
spent
true